Larouco, Windham win 17-inning classic

"We played three games," said winning coach Leo Gravell with a weary laugh. Right he was as his Windham squad beat Spaulding, 7-6, in 17 innings. In the bottom of the 17th, Owen Larouco reached on a lead-off infield single to the shortstop deep in the hole. Keegan Parke then walked. With one out, Windham executed a double steal. With two outs, they scored the winner on a wild pitch. The relief pitching was sensational. For Windham, Charlie Breen went 9.1 innings of scoreless relief. He gave up three hits, no runs, 10 strikeouts and two walks. Then Joey Blair threw three innings of 1-hit, shutout relief. Braydan Decotis gave up no hits in the top of the 17th to earn the win. Gravell said, "We can withstand a game like that better than most because we have 5-6 guys who can throw strikes." Larouco was also the defensive star at second base. He made "3-4 plays to preserve the tie," said Gravell. Josh Scammon was the hard-luck loser. All he did was pitch 10 innings of 4-hit relief with his only run the unearned game-winner.
